Brent’s diversity is evident to all who visit our borough and our long history of ethnic and cultural diversity has created a place that is truly unique and valued by those who live and work here.   The council is pursuing a far-reaching transformation agenda that better meets the needs of our community so it is an exciting time to join us.   The Post The Housing Service is recruiting Income Project Officers to support the delivery of a proactive and customer-focused income management service across Brent. This is an exciting opportunity to join a developing service focused on improving income collection, tenancy sustainment, and resident outcomes. Working closely with the Income Maximisation Manager and wider housing teams, you will support targeted projects and interventions aimed at maximising rental income and improving performance across a range of tenures and portfolios. You will manage complex arrears cases, support early intervention activity, and work collaboratively with residents and internal teams to achieve positive outcomes.  The role will involve delivering project-based work linked to rent recovery, welfare support, legal escalation, and tenancy sustainment. You will be expected to maintain accurate records, use housing management systems effectively, and ensure all work is carried out in line with relevant legislation, policies, and pre-action protocol. The role requires someone who can work independently, manage competing priorities, and contribute to service improvements within a fast-paced housing environment. The Person We are looking for motivated and solution-focused individuals with experience in income recovery, rent arrears management, or housing management within a social housing environment. You will have strong knowledge of welfare benefits, including Universal Credit, and an understanding of rent arrears recovery, the Pre-Action Protocol, and relevant housing legislation relating to tenancy, income, and housing management.    The successful candidates will: * Have experience managing complex or high-risk arrears cases * Be confident working with residents to achieve sustainable outcomes * Have strong negotiation, communication, and problem-solving skills * Be able to manage competing priorities and work across multiple projects * Work effectively with internal teams and external partners * Demonstrate strong attention to detail, particularly when managing arrears cases, maintaining records, and reviewing account information * Maintain accurate records and use housing management systems confidently * Be proactive in identifying opportunities to improve services and performance * Demonstrate excellent customer service skills and a positive, can-do approach You will be highly organised, self-motivated, and committed to delivering high-quality services that support residents while maximising income collection for the service Why join us?
